"You're such a jerk." Conrad's roar was low as he grabbed Ernest by the collar.

My heart skipped a beat, and without caring about my own sorrow, I was about to intervene when Ernest coolly responded, "Mr. Wagner, maybe you think I'm despicable because you've never put your heart into treating Licia the way I do?"

Conrad's gaze narrowed sharply. "Ernest, your little high school tricks won't fool Felicia. She doesn't like all that smoke and mirrors, get it?"

Didn't I like it? Indeed, I had once told Conrad I didn't.

I remember our first Valentine's Day after we became an item; he didn't get me anything, not even dinner.

The next day, while having lunch with Jefferson and some friends, Jefferson jokingly asked how Conrad had spent our first Valentine's Day together.

I was so embarrassed at that moment, and later, when Conrad apologized saying he had forgotten, I had to save face by claiming I didn't like such things.

But what girl doesn't appreciate flowers and a bit of romance? The problem was, he never offered any!

"Do you still think she doesn't like it?" Ernest asked softly.
